 Obtusalin Biological Activity

Description Obtusalin is a triterpenoid found in R. dauricum for the first time and shows UV absorption at 210 nm. Obtusalin has some antibacterial activity[1][2].
Related Catalog
In Vitro Obtusalin (0.781-100 µg/mL, 24 h) has antibacterial activity against Enterococcus faecalis ATCC 10541, Providensia smartii ATCC 29916, Staphylococcus aureus ATCC 25922 and Escherichia coli ATCC 8739 with the MIC values of 50, 100, 50 and 100 μg/mL, respectively[1].
